Understanding Ergonomics
Ergonomics is the science of designing products that fit the human body and its cognitive abilities. The primary goal is to enhance comfort, efficiency, and safety. In the context of workplace gear, especially personal protective equipment like safety shoes, ergonomics ensures that products not only protect but also promote health and well-being.
Ergonomic Applications in Safety Shoe Design
Ergonomic safety shoes are designed to provide superior comfort and support, reducing fatigue and the risk of injury. These shoes often feature advanced cushioning for shock absorption, arch support tailored to different foot shapes, breathable materials for temperature regulation, and optimized weight distribution to reduce strain during long hours of wear.

Innovative Materials and Technologies
The incorporation of new materials such as memory foam insoles and lightweight synthetic fabrics is transforming safety shoe design. Technologies like 3D printing allow for precise customization, improving fit and comfort while also streamlining production processes. These innovations contribute to a more personalized and efficient approach to safety footwear.
